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E A surgical microscope apparatus for use while suturing an incision in the cornea for configuring the cornea to a spherical surface having a radius of curvature of a predetermined magnitude is disclosed. The micro- scope system includes a light source for projecting an image onto the cornea and prisms for optically splitting the image on the cornea into a plurality of images within the surgical field of view for viewing through the binocular eyepieces. The optical system can be adjusted to orient the images into a predetermined alignment and configuration indicative of the radius of curva- ture, the alignment and configuration occurring when the cornea sutures are tensioned correctly to indicate a spherical surface of the predetermined radius of curvature. The prisms are so-positioned to permit a portion of the surgical field of view to pass through the microscope undeviated to enable the surgeon to utilize the necessary suturing tools without multiple images of the tools. In a first embodiment a fixed location prism array is utili- lized for optically splitting the image and the optical system is adjusted by varying the magnification powers of the microscope. In a second embodiment, rotary prisms are in a fixed position within the optical path for optically splitting the image and the optical system is adjusted by varying the prism power.
